Best day to fill up — Premium Diesel in South Australia
Fill up on Mon or Tue, avoid Wed or Thu
South Australia shows moderate price cycling with mid-week peaks. Start-of-week refueling (Monday/Tuesday) offers the best value in South Australia.

Premium Diesel in South Australia Insights

How have Premium Diesel prices in South Australia moved over the past 81 days?

Over the past 81 days, Premium Diesel in South Australia has averaged 215.0c per litre, peaking at 251.1c on 29 April and bottoming out at 175.3c on 1 July — a range of 75.8c. Over the past week the SA average has risen 31.1c. Timing a fill-up around that range matters: on a 50-litre tank, filling at the period low instead of the peak saves $37.90.
